題 名 | 玫瑰桉葉精油含量及化學成分研究 |

中文摘要 | 本研究係探尋不同季節及不同蒸餾時間之玫瑰桉(Eucalyptus grandis (Hill) Maiden)葉部精油含量及其化學成分之變化,精油含量係使用水蒸氣蒸餾法測定,化學成分係採用氣相層析儀(GC)之滯留時間 (retention time)及氣相層析-質譜儀(GC-MS)之質譜圖鑑定。精油含量在不同季節中夏季(2.38%(v/w))最高,次為春季(1.94%(v/w)),再次為冬季(1.74%(v/w)),最低者為秋季(0.91%(v/w))。在不同蒸餾時間之含精油量差異,含油量隨時間而增加,但蒸餾6小時以後含量增加不多。使用GC及GC-MS鑑定出玫瑰桉葉精油有22個成分,主要成分為1, 8-cineole,α-pinene,β-phellandrene,ρ-cymene及α-terpineol等,其他尚有17個少量成分。在不同季節之成分含量,春季及夏季主要成分為α-pinene,其含量依序為52.05及28.22%,秋冬主要成分為1,8-cineole ,其含量分別為38.6及54.83%,顯然隨季節之不同所含主成分之含量有差別。在不同蒸餾時間(2、4、6及8小時)主成分均為α-pinene,隨蒸餾時增長,各精油成分含量有差異,但變化不大。 |
英文摘要 | The purpose of this study were to determine the variation in yields and components of essential oil arose from seasonal variation, and different distillation times, in the leaves of Eucalyptus grandis. Essential oils were obtained by stem distillation. Components of the essential oils were analyzed and identified by means of the retention time (Rt) of gas chromatograph (GC) and gas chromtograph-mass spectrometry (GC-MS). For season variation in the yields of essential oils of Eucalyptus grandis leaves, the highest yield was observed in Aummer (2.38% v/w), followed by Spring (1.94% v/w), and Winter (1.74% v/w), and the lowest yield was in Autum (0.91% v/w). Yields of essential oils obtained from Eucalyptus grandis leaves being distilled for 2, 4, 6 and 8 hours were 1.30, 1.94, 2.38 and 2.44% v/w, respectively. The yield of essential oil increased with increasing distillation time and showed no significant differences after 6 hours of distillation. Twenty two components (Table 3) were identified in the essential oil of Eucalyptus grandis leaves. The main components were 1,8-cineole, α-pinene, β-phellandrene, ρ-cymene and β-terpineol. The major components of Eucalyptus grandis leaves at different seasons was α-pinene in Spring (52.05%) and Summer (28.22%), and 1, 8-cineole in Autum (38.62%), and Winter (54.83%). The essentil oil gave varying major component content at different season. At different distillation periods, the major component was α-pinene, There were little difference in contents of each component with respect to distillation time. |
